Preparing for iOS 17 Release
The hosts discuss the upcoming release of iOS 17 and the importance of preparing developer devices for testing. They recommend downgrading test devices to iOS 16 and disabling automatic updates to ensure compatibility testing. They also advise labeling devices with relevant software versions to keep track of testing setups. The hosts caution against releasing app updates with iOS 17 features immediately, as most users won't be running the new iOS version right away, leading to potential confusion. Additionally, they remind developers to avoid directly mentioning iOS 17 in release notes to prevent rejections based on mention of pre-release software.
